Prescribed Accommodation
Any business running a prescribed accommodation premises, must follow the:
Business types
- Holiday camps
- Hostel
- Motel/hotel
- Residential Accommodation
- Rooming house with temporary or shared accommodation
- Student dormitory

Change of ownership
As the new owner/purchaser, you need to transfer the business into your name. It is a legal requirement to have both the new and existing owners’ signatures on the application form.
- Step 1 – Complete and submit the Application form.
- Step 2 – Your application will be assigned to an Officer who will liaise with you throughout the process.
- Step 3 – You will be provided with a Registration Certificate once approved by the Officer and payment of the invoice is made.

How to appeal an Infringement
If you are issued with an infringement for a premises registered with council, you can apply to have the matter reviewed. To apply for internal review, please complete and submit an online application.
